Info on Punjab villages on the Net now

June 08, 2015 12:00 am | Updated 05:41 am IST - Chandigarh:

Rural Development and Panchayats Minister Sikander Singh Maluka on Sunday said information of all 13,040 villages in the State has been uploaded on the official website of the Punjab government.

Punjab has become the first State to put data of all its 13,040 villages on its official website, Mr. Maluka claimed.

Functioning of Gram Panchayats in Punjab has been strengthened through computerisation under e-panchayats scheme, he said.

It will provide details of famous personalities, popular and historical places of a particular village, latest data of Gram Panchayats and mapped villages, distance of village from main cities and main roads, schools, colleges, hospitals, community centres and centre and state sponsored schemes going on in villages, he said. - PTI
